Red Corner
On the verge of signing a huge business deal, attorney Jack Moore is on top of the world. But his elation soon comes tumbling down after he spends the night with a beautiful woman...and is then accused of her brutal murder! At the mercy of the strict Chinese court system--where one is guilty until proven innocent--Jack finds himself completely alone. But when his defense attorney unearths puzzling contradictions in the case, she acts against the court and her country, joining him in a pulse-pounding race to find the true killer...while both of their lives hang in the balance!
